Very excited to share our work on mechanosensitive control of cell contractility by the putative ion channel Tmc, now online in @currentbiology.bsky.social. Very grateful for this fantastic collaboration with the Großhans lab! www.cell.com/current-biol...
Synchronization in epithelial tissue morphogenesis
Richa et al. demonstrate that Tmc, a mechano-gated channel in vertebrate hearing, synchronizes cell dynamics in the epithelial amnioserosa of Drosophila embryos. Experimental data together with a data...

Richa, Häring @mathherring.bsky.social‬ et al uncover that the very proteins transducing sound into neuronal activity in the ear, in embryogenesis coordinate epithelial cell movements. Early in #evolution, mechanotransduction perhaps "listened" to intra-organism forces doi 10.1016/j.cub.2025.03.066
